Bill Clinton was discharged after hospitalization for the flu



Former President Clinton was released Tuesday morning after being hospitalized a day earlier with the flu, according to his spokesman.

“He and his family are deeply grateful for the exceptional care provided by the team at MedStar Georgetown University Hospital and are touched by the kind messages and well wishes he received,” spokesman Angel Ureña added Tuesday in the morning publication to X. “Sending his warmest wishes for a happy and healthy holiday to all.”

Clinton was admitted in Washington hospital Monday with fever.

“President Clinton was admitted to MedStar University Hospital in Georgetown this afternoon for tests and observation after developing a fever,” Ureña wrote on social media. “He remains in good spirits and is deeply appreciative of the excellent care he is receiving.”

The former Democratic president was active during the 2024 presidential campaign, supporting Vice President Harris in her bid against President-elect Trump. Months before, he spoke at the Democratic National Convention that took place in Chicago.

The former president spent five days in the hospital in 2021 with sepsis caused by an infection.
